Wild pachyderms destroy houses in Margherita

Tension prevailed at Margherita Subdivision when wild pachyderms in search of food came out from nearby Forest Reserve. The herd of elephants completely destroyed 4 houses at 2 Number Makum Pather Gaon on Friday midnight.

According to sources, a group of elephants in search of food came out and entered 2 Number Makum Pather Gaon under Makum Pather Gaon panchayat of Margherita Subdivision, which getting any food Wild Pachyderm completely destroyed 4 houses injuring, unfortunately, all those who were present at the houses manage to escape but one Rajen Tanti (38) was seriously attacked by wild Pachyderm and got injured.

Immediately injure Rajen Tanti was taken to Margherita Civil Hospital for treatment. Meanwhile, Ahom Sabha Margherita Sub division Committee General Secretary Utap Konwar have to Forest Department officials to Provide full compensation to those whose houses were destroyed and to provide better medical facilities to Rajen Tanti.

It may be mention that many previously trees were mercilessly chopped at Margherita Subdivision which falls under Digboi Forest for that is the cause of Wild Pachyderm moves to residential areas in search of food. The Digboi Forest Division Divisional Forest officer Atiqur Rehman has not taken any step to take stringent action against those who were involved in chopping precious mercilessly at Margherita Subdivision under Digboi Forest Division which Nature Lovers of Margherita have raised many questions against Digboi Forest Division Divisional Forest Officer Atiqur Rehman.

Man vs wildlife conflicts have increased ever since the lockdown with several other instances in Assam.
